With this device configuration file, are you able to use bidirectional scanning, overscanning, and offset scanning without the laser slowing down and burning uneven images?
For smaller images, or just plain fill layers, yes. An image has so many power shifts on a single line we actually saturate the Wecreat’s serial input buffer, so it slows down and causes uneven burn.
That’s an issue that we are aware of and discussed with them, and they are trying to fix it in the firmware. This isn’t something we can do on our end at the moment.
The full fix will eventually be to implement the file upload feature they designed for Makeit, but we don’t have the necessary architecture to allow that at present. We’re working towards it, though.

I rarely do actual images, so it should be good on basic object fills now? That’s great news!
I mean, again it’s going to depend on the level of detail, because it’s dependent on the number of power changes power second during a scanning line.
And the speed will matter too, the faster it goes, the less time there is to send the next instructions.
